On July 20, 2023, the National Stock Exchange (NSE) placed six stocks under a ban in the futures and options (F&O) segment.
The ban was imposed because these securities exceeded 95 %of the market-wide position limit (MWPL), according to the NSE.

The NSE updates the list of securities under the F&O ban daily based on the market-wide position limit. Traders and members were informed that they could only trade derivative contracts of the banned securities to decrease their positions through offsetting trades.
Any increase in open positions during the ban period will lead to appropriate penal and disciplinary action, as per the NSE’s announcement. No fresh positions are allowed for any F&O contracts related to the specified stocks during the ban period.
The NSE implemented the ban to regulate trading activities and prevent excessive speculation, ensuring fair and stable market conditions. Traders are advised to comply with the guidelines to avoid penalties and adverse consequences.
